t: saveState для сохранения состояния управляемого компонента с помощью RequestScope - State for Pagination System - PullRequest
1 голос
/ 26 ноября 2011

Я пытаюсь работать с tomahawk-saveState, но он просто не работает. Я вставил следующий код в мой файл xhtml (JSF2.0):

 <t:saveState value="#{managedBean1}"/>

Использование такого управляемого компонента:

 @ManagedBean
 @RequestScoped
 public class ManagedBean1 implements Serializable {...}

Я связываю это с системой нумерации страниц, чтобы она могла сохранять состояние номера страницы во время навигации по этой странице. Теперь, когда я открываю страницу, система нумерации страниц становится пустой и создает себя (хорошо) , но затем я обновляю страницу (F5) или нажимаю на следующую страницу, и система нумерации страниц снова становится пустой. и бин создает его снова . Итак, как вы можете видеть, нумерация страниц не работает, потому что она не может сохранить состояние, так что я могу делать неправильно?

Любая помощь будет оценена. Спасибо.

...